Abstract: The importance of the inverse scattering problem for the Schrödinger equation with energy-dependent potential:
y"={ζ2-[u(x)+ζv(x)]}y=0 (1) has been noticed by quite a few authors. Jaulent and Miodek[1] have used it to solve some nonlinear evolution equations with isospectral condition ζt=0. Li and Zhuang[2,3] have further made use of (1) to expand the solvable class of nonlinear evolution equations. Several physical problems in absorption media can be reduced to the inverse scattoring problem of(1) (see[4]).
